Lock Maintenance: Keeping Your Property Secure
Keeping up locks is crucial for ensuring the protection of a property. Consistent lock maintenance helps spot possible issues before they escalate into serious problems. Examining locks for wear and tear can stop malfunction and unauthorized access. Lubrication is essential; applying graphite-based or silicone-based lubricants keeps the mechanisms operating smoothly, preventing sticking or jamming.
Additionally, trained locksmiths can offer counsel on the right maintenance schedule determined by the type of locks and environmental conditions. They can also inspect for related resource alignment issues, which may compromise security if left unaddressed. Property owners should be proactive, including lock maintenance into their normal security measures.
In addition to prolonging the lifespan of locks, diligent maintenance strengthens the total safety of a property. Committing to regular lock assessments ensures peace of mind, knowing that all entry points are protected and operating effectively. Ultimately, maintaining locks is a vital component of complete property security.

Security System Types
Security systems function as vital protectors for residential and commercial properties, providing peace of mind in an increasingly uncertain world. Various types of security systems cater to different needs and preferences. Breach detection systems use sensors to alert occupants of unauthorized access, while surveillance cameras track activity in real-time or record for future examination. Access control systems oversee entry through biometric scanners, keypads, or access cards, enhancing security for restricted areas. Additionally, alarm systems can be straight connected to local authorities, guaranteeing rapid response in emergencies. Smart home security systems connect to mobile devices, permitting remote monitoring and control. By recognizing these options, individuals can choose the best security solution to safeguard their property and loved ones efficiently.

Smart Locks: Tomorrow's Home Security Solution
With advancing technology, smart locks are becoming a key solution for modern home security. These innovative devices provide advanced functionalities that traditional locks can't replicate, improving both convenience and safety for homeowners. Smart locks can be commanded remotely through smartphones, permitting users to lock or unlock doors from anywhere. Many models provide keyless entry options, such as fingerprint recognition or numerical keypads, eliminating the need for physical keys.
Additionally, smart locks can connect with home automation systems, ensuring seamless connectivity with other smart devices. Alerts and notifications can be delivered to users' phones, informing them of unauthorized access attempts or when the door is left unsecured. This technology not only improves everyday life but also improves security measures, making it more challenging for intruders to bypass. As smart locks increase in popularity, they are transforming the landscape of home security, ensuring peace of mind in an increasingly connected world.

What Should I Do When My Key Breaks Inside the Lock?
When a key breaks inside the lock, one should avoid attempting to force it. Alternatively, tweezers or a magnet can be used to pull out the piece or call a professional locksmith for safe extraction assistance.

What Are the Fees for Locksmith Services?
Expenses related to locksmith services vary widely, typically ranging from $50 to $200 for standard services. Complex services, for example safe installations or emergency interventions, can go beyond $300, contingent upon the exact specifications and time needed.
